Abstract
The utility model discloses an instrument impact sensor, which is used with an instrumented impact tester. The instrumented impact sensor comprises a cuboid elastomeric support, one end of the elastomeric support is connected with a cutting edge, the elastomeric support is provided with a groove, and a strain plate is arranged in the groove. When in use, an impact sample contacts with a measuring point at the end of the cutting edge, the cutting edge and the elastomeric support deform due to stress, and physical deformation is transmitted to the strain plate so that electric signals in the strain plate are changed. The instrumented impact sensor can effectively measure force load of samples in impact testing processes.

Embodiment
To shown in Figure 5, it comprises the elastic body bearing 2 of a rectangular shape instrumentation shock transducer as Fig. 1, connects blade 3 in elastic body bearing lower end, has groove 4 on the elastic body bearing 2, is provided with foil gauge 5 in the groove.Elastic body bearing 2 and blade 3 all are connected with base 1, and base 1 is provided with screw hole 6.Screw hole 6 is used for being connected with the hammer body of impact testing machine, fixes.
As Fig. 1, Fig. 2 and shown in Figure 4, it is identical and be symmetrical structure all to have groove 4, two groove shapes sizes on elastic body bearing 2 two sides parallel with the blade cutting edge, foil gauge 5, two foil gauge circuits all is housed in two grooves 4 connects and form electric bridge.Between two grooves 4, all dug cable hole 7 in elastic body bearing 2 and the base 1, be convenient to the circuit cabling and the signal output of foil gauge 5.
As shown in Figure 1, angle is 30 degree between two inclined-planes of blade, and cutting edge cross section, blade lower end is circular-arc, and arc radius is 2 millimeters.
Foil gauge as shown in Figure 2, cutting edge position, blade 3 lower right is force-detecting position (contact point of sample and sensor is force-detecting position).Foil gauge 5 is positioned at the force-detecting position back upper place, and it can directly experience impact deformation.
The instrumentation shock transducer is a strain beam type force transducer.During use, impact specimen contacts with the force-detecting position of blade 3 limit ends, blade 3 and the 2 stressed generation deformation of elastic body bearing, and physical deformation conducts to foil gauge 5, and the electric signal in the foil gauge is changed.
Blade lower end cutting edge as shown in Figure 1, the arc radius in cross section also can be 8 millimeters.
